说到以太坊,很多人的第一反应是“智能合约”,那代币又是啥呢?简单来说,以太坊代币是基于以太坊网络发出的数字资产。这些代币可以代表任何东西:从游戏里的道具到现实中的资产,嘿,甚至可以是你的一杯咖啡!通过以太坊的ERC-20标准,创建代币变得非常简单。
在开始交易之前,你得先有个以太坊钱包。其实,建立个钱包真的跟选衣服一样,得挑到合适的。现在,有很多类型的钱包可选,像是硬件钱包、软件钱包、甚至手机钱包。要是你是新手,使用软件钱包,比如MetaMask,会比较方便。它支持大多数的代币,操作也简单明了。
怎么创建?先去官网下载MetaMask,按照步骤安装,接着设定好你的账号和密码,最重要的是,确保把助记词和密码保存好,不然你可能会辛苦得来的币就这样飞了。
你心中是不是也想过,嘿,我也想发行个代币呢!其实,创建一个自己的ERC-20代币也不是难事。你可以使用像Remix这样的在线工具,只需简单的代码,就能创建出代币。
例如,你可以用以下简单的Solidity代码创建一个代币:
pragma solidity ^0.8.0;
contract MyToken {
string public name = "MyToken";
string public symbol = "MTK";
uint8 public decimals = 18;
uint public totalSupply = 1000000 * (10 ** uint(decimals));
mapping (address =